WebIn statistics, the Dickey–Fuller test tests the null hypothesis that a unit root is present in an autoregressive (AR) time series model. The alternative hypothesis is different depending on which version of the test is used, but is usually stationarity or trend-stationarity.The test is named after the statisticians David Dickey and Wayne Fuller, who developed it in 1979.
